Farm workers vs Office managers Salary (2025)
How do Farm workers and Office managers sal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.
Office managers earns £6,903 more per year (24% higher)
Detailed Comparison
| Metric | Farm workers | Office managers |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Median Annual | £29,101 | £36,004 | -£6,903 |
| Mean Annual | £29,320 | £38,180 | -£8,860 |
| Monthly | £2,425 | £3,000 | -£575 |
| Weekly | £560 | £692 | -£132 |
| Hourly | £13.99 | £17.31 | -£3.32 |
